The cabac inline assembly is very brittle to assemble properly
on i386 windows with clang; libavcodec/hevc_cabac.c fails to build
in the default mode (which is -march=pentium4), it only works if
ffmpeg is configured with --cpu=i686 (translating to -march=i686),
and likewise, the inline assembly fails to assemble in
libavcodec/h264_cabac.c if building with optimizations disabled.

Instead of trying to step around the problem (and end up bit by it
occasionally), just disable the inline assembly for this configuration.

That's a good question - how are you building? I can reproduce it both in mingw and msvc mode.

In mingw mode (with my llvm-mingw toolchains from https://github.com/mstorsjo/llvm-mingw, but any clang configured to target i386 mingw should do), I can reproduce it (in a cross compile setup) like this (tested with Clang 10.0 but any version should do, I remember seeing the issue long ago):

$ configure --cross-prefix=i686-w64-mingw32- --target-os=mingw32 --arch=i686 --enable-gpl
$ make V=1

The same also seems to trigger in the same way if using the clang-cl frontend, e.g. configured like this:

configure --enable-gpl --arch=i686 --cc=clang-cl --ld=lld-link --target-os=win32 --toolchain=msvc --enable-cross-compile --ar=llvm-ar --nm=llvm-nm --disable-stripping --extra-cflags=-m32


In the first two cases, adding --cpu=i686 to the configure line, which converts into -march=i686 on the compile commands, makes the issue go away. For clang-cl, --cpu=i686 doesn't have any effect, so the issue doesn't easily go away there.

Now if configuring with --cpu=i686 --disable-optimizations, the same issues are back again, in both libavcodec/h264_cabac.o and libavcodec/hevc_cabac.o.
